Employers in Zoar, WI, have adopted drug testing policies to ensure a safe and productive workplace. These policies often include pre-employment screening, random drug testing, and testing after workplace incidents. Employers aim to discourage substance abuse among employees while also maintaining compliance with state and federal guidelines, such as those outlined by the U.S. Department of Labor.
Many businesses in Zoar are committed to following best practices as prescribed by the Wisconsin Department of Workforce Development. Drug testing helps Zoar employers reduce workplace accidents and health-related costs by identifying and addressing substance abuse issues early. This also contributes to creating a safe environment both for employees and the community at large.
Under Wisconsin law, employers must ensure that their drug testing policies are fair and non-discriminatory. More information on legal standards can be found at the Wisconsin Labor Standards Bureau. Businesses are advised to clearly communicate these policies to all employees and offer support through Employee Assistance Programs for those who seek help voluntarily.
Zoar's employers often coordinate with third-party testing services to conduct reliable and confidential drug tests. The results are used to make informed decisions without compromising employee privacy. For guidance on conducting fair drug tests, employers can consult resources from the U.S. Equal Employment Opportunity Commission.
